Customers are saying
Customers find value in the Platinum Wireless 7.1 Virtual Surround Sound Gaming Headset's exceptional sound quality and comfortable design. Many appreciate the long battery life and wireless convenience, although some experienced connection issues. While the immersive 3D audio is praised, a few users noted the headset's weight and price as potential drawbacks.

Rated 2 out of 5 stars
Decent.. when/if it works
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.First I will say that in my opinion this headset sounds better than the original version of the ps golds. The platinums have a much more full sound. Whenever you would turn the VSS on the golds, it seemed turn the bass completely off. Not on the plats though. The issue is that I could not keep these paired. They would cut out every few minutes and would reset the sound settings every single time. So... I brought them back. If you get them, I hope you have better luck than I
